Definition from Otto Mathias book "Chemometrics":
chemical discipline that uses mathematics and statistical methods,
-to design or select optimal measurement procedures and
experiments, and
-to provide maximum chemical information by analyzing chemical
data

< > Is there a package for chemometrics and/or analysis of variance ?
<
< I never heard of chemometrics. Could you explain a little more?
<
< > I know there is Matlab toolbox, do someone know if it can be
< > imported in SciLab.
<
< If you have a matlab toolbox you may have a chance to port it to
< octave (www.octave.org). You have to use the development version wich
< is pretty stable and the octave-forge (www.sf.net -> seach for octave
< the first hit) package. This brings a lot of Matlab compatibily.
